In your drawing template, styles and standards editor, you can create all the text types you want in the text section. Then you can go and define what dimensions styles/leaders/etc use what text. Once you have it all set, then make sure to save that to your styles library. Make sure the project file "Use style library" is set to read-write so you can actually write to it. All other drawings then you should be able to use the "Update" Button in the styles panel and it will update all older drawings with what is in the styles library.

I suspect there is some sort of style corruption (those styles with $ sign) in your drawing template or drawing file. I assume it was an AutoCAD dwg file converted to an Inventor dwg file. I would use AutoCAD RECOVER command to repair the dwg file. Then use PURGE command to remove any duplicate styles.
